Sides like Hawthorn and Richmond have been efficient in their MCG finals this century.

Collingwood and Melbourne...not so much.

From 2000 onwards, Collingwood's record at the MCG in Finals against non-Victorian teams reads:

2025 PF: lost to Brisbane
2023 GF: defeated Brisbane
2023 PF: defeated GWS
2022 SF: defeated Fremantle
2019 PF: lost to GWS
2019 GF: lost to West Coast
2018 SF: defeated GWS
2013 EF: lost to Port Adelaide
2012 SF: defeated West Coast
2011 QF: defeated West Coast
2009 SF: defeated Adelaide
2007 EF: defeated Sydney
2003 GF: lost to Brisbane
2003 PF: defeated Port Adelaide
2003 QF: defeated Brisbane
2002 GF: lost to Brisbane
2002 PF: defeated Adelaide

17 games: 11 wins, 6 losses

Hawthorn and Richmond are examples of MCG clubs who utilise their home ground advantage in finals.
Back when the Hawks would finish top2 on the ladder they had a great record, they went 11-1 in MCG finals as they were the best team.

They have gone 1-5 in their last six finals at the G, including two straight sets exits. The neutral MCG doesn't help much if you ain't the best team

Pies are similar, finish top 2, Pies have a 10-2 record in MCG finals.

The Pies "problem" is that we finish 4th or 6th a lot, and then do well to even make it to a PF or GF and then lost to stronger teams who are also usually familiar at the G themselves.
